Solution
The correct option is A Commensalism
Commensalism : This is the interaction in which one species benefits and the other is neither harmed nor benefited.
Parasitism : This is the interaction in which one organism, called the parasite, lives on or in another organism called the host, causing it some harm.
Competition : This is is an interaction between organisms or species in which two organisms or species compete with one another for a limiting resource.
Amensalism : This is an association between organisms of two different species in which one is inhibited or destroyed and the other is unaffected.
Therefore, option a) commensalism is the correct answer
